Jie Cui is a scholar working on Atomic and Molecular Physics, and Optics, Electrical and Electronic Engineering and Spectroscopy. According to data from OpenAlex, Jie Cui has authored 32 papers receiving a total of 891 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Atomic and Molecular Physics, and Optics, 14 papers in Electrical and Electronic Engineering and 10 papers in Spectroscopy. Recurrent topics in Jie Cui's work include Advanced Chemical Physics Studies (8 papers), Advanced Battery Materials and Technologies (8 papers) and Advancements in Battery Materials (8 papers). Jie Cui is often cited by papers focused on Advanced Chemical Physics Studies (8 papers), Advanced Battery Materials and Technologies (8 papers) and Advancements in Battery Materials (8 papers). Jie Cui collaborates with scholars based in China, Japan and United States. Jie Cui's co-authors include Guoxue Liu, Huawen Huang, Lei Zhang, Ran Bi, Roman V. Krems, Dingyuan Yan, Ben Zhong Tang, Lei Wang, Dong Wang and Ting Han and has published in prestigious journals such as Journal of the American Chemical Society, Physical Review Letters and Advanced Materials.
